The future of Europe’s green steel market: challenges and catalysts
The European green steel market, crucial for meeting the EU's climate goals, faces challenges from high input costs, economic pressures, and trade uncertainties, while transitioning to low-carbon production methods like hydrogen-based steelmaking offers a pathway to near-zero emissions.

EAF transition key to US green steel: consultant
The transition from blast furnace (BF) steel production to electric-arc furnaces (EAF) provides a clear path to achieving zero-emissions steel, with producers considering hitting sustainability targets and lower costs, Wade Wright, a steel consultant told participants at a green steel webinar held by Jefferies Equity Research on Monday August 12
